£2,400 for a Grand Lizard !! I once heard that it is a rare game, but pinside and ipdb both state 2,750 units which I would think is about average. It is ranked 158 on pinside, which is also about average.

It has some neat features- double magna save, mini pf. Art is a mismatch with different artists for the PF and Backglass (like Future Spa)

I have played a couple of examples. It did not strike me as a mega title. Quite easy to get multiball.

2400 used to be very strong money for a System 11.
